Ticket: Staging env misconfigured for Siftgate bloom filter

The bloom layer in front of the Pellet KV store is rejecting all lookups in staging because the env file was copied from the dev template without credentials. False-positive tuning values are fine; only the auth line is missing. To unblock the weekly demo, the Pellet admission secret must be set on the following line.

env line for yaguf-fajop: LEDGER_TOKEN13=fb08984397349

### Step 3: Repoint workers

After draining the old Fernhollow transcode farm, repoint each worker at the new Pinecone scheduler. Workers re-register automatically; jobs in flight on old nodes finish there. Do not mix old and new workers in one pool — priority handling differs. Confirm registration in the scheduler dashboard before closing the ticket. Each repointed worker must start with the following configuration values.

config for bawig-fadup:
[zorix]
host = zorix.lumicworks.corp
user = zorix_svc
database = zorix_prod

For department heads ahead of the leadership review. Tarnwick Holdings has assessed Quillest Systems, a mid-sized tooling firm based in Fenbrook, as an acquisition target. Due diligence shows stable revenue, modest debt, and overlap with our Ardent line that would consolidate two supply chains. Integration would take roughly nine months, led by Operations. Valuation discussions remain preliminary and should not be referenced outside this group. The strategic rationale is summarized in the confidential note below.

board note of kageg-bahof: The renewal with Holwynax Holdings closes at $2 million a year, 5 percent below the last contract. Project Ulaath slips by two quarters because of the supplier delay.

# Customer Concentration Risk (Managers Only)

Sales leads, a friendly flag: Merrow Industrial now accounts for just under 40% of our recurring revenue. Great account, but if they wobble, we wobble. Their renewal lands in the spring, and their procurement team has been asking pointed questions about pricing. Short-term ask: prioritise pipeline outside the Merrow relationship and log any churn signals promptly. Our mitigation plan is set out in the note below.

confidential, kagup-bafog: Fraaxax Group is in early talks to buy Soroxox Group for about $343.8 million. The Olidor launch date is June 14, and nothing goes to the press before then. Legal wants the Aldmirek Logistics term sheet signed before July 23.